Ha! I really like that song, though I haven't heard much else from Ms. Chapman other than "Give One Reason To Stay Here". I believe she sings "Fast Car" that way for effect. It's a kind of conversational singing. Paul Simon does this sometimes, too. The beauty of it in "Fast Car" is that it illustrates the unstable, anxious life of the character in the song. It also adds to the emphasis when she sings "I--eee--I.." The lullabye groove of the music is the underlying bed of rhythm. At least that's what I hear and it's quite beautiful, IMO.

I read "song that does not rhyme" to mean a song with no logical rhyme scheme.

So while there are some words in "My Life Is Good" that rhyme eventually, I guess I didn't detect a pattern. Using "us" to end 2 consective lines isn't a rhyme. IMO, neither are "room", "school", and "too" (close, but not quite there).

I had never noticed that "Surrender" doesn't rhyme, but I always felt that there was something jarring about the lyrics. That's what it was- it really gets your attention. It's interesting how that's effective in different ways with some of these different songs: it makes the Pink Floyd sound conversational, while it gives the BOC songs a kind of prose storytelling feel. And it helps the Randy Newman songs sound so offbeat.
